The Roadies have two groups, Regular & Long. Regular rides are 35-45 miles and Long rides are 45-60 (sometimes longer) miles long. There are strong riders in each group but Long riders are faster and a bit more competitive. The Regular riders regroup more often and for longer times. Average speeds for the whole ride for Regular rides is 14-16 and 16-18 for the Long rides. We are not a "racing" oriented club. If someone really is too slow we make sure they know where they are and how to get back to the start. Route slips are provided for weekend rides. Riders are expected to follow the NCCC Road Riding Rules of Etiquette. Riders must wear helmets meeting CPSC or Snell safety standards.
